Future of Razor Pages
I recently tried out Razor Pages and even though I heard nothing but criticisms, I am thoroughly impressed by how intuitive and amazing they are. One of the vital criticism I heard was that Razor Page is essentially WebForm 2.0 and it destroys the ideology of separation of concerns. This is completely bs, and I realized it after using it extensively on a few projects. I am currently in love with Razor Pages and already transferred a few of my MVC projects to Razor Pages.
However, given the huge negative back-lash that the community has given, I am afraid of its future. I don't know about you, but I will suggest you to at least give it a try before riding the hate train. Regardless, I am concerned as to whether Microsoft will continue to support this as the general feedback appears to lean heavily on the negative side.
